C1403 — Traction Control Valve RF Circuit Short To Battery

**Introduction**
The diagnostic trouble code (DTC) **C1403** indicates a **short circuit in the Right Front (RF) traction control valve circuit** to the vehicle’s battery. This fault is related to the Anti-lock Braking System (ABS) that manages traction and stability. It typically points to an electrical issue within the traction control or ABS system, affecting the vehicle’s ability to control wheel traction effectively.

What does trouble code C1403 mean?

**In simple terms:**
C1403 points to an **electrical fault in the RF (Right Front) traction control (or ABS) valve circuit**, specifically a **short circuit to the vehicle’s battery voltage**. This circuit controls the operation of a solenoid within the traction or ABS system that manages brake fluid pressure to individual wheels, helping to prevent wheel spin.

**What the ECU monitors:**
The engine control unit (ECU), or more accurately the vehicle’s ABS control module, continuously monitors the electrical circuits linked to the traction control and ABS valves for correct voltage levels and integrity.

**What triggers the code:**
This code is set when the ECU detects a **short circuit to the battery voltage** in the RF traction control valve circuit. This can happen due to damaged wiring, a faulty valve, or a component shorted to ground or the battery.

**Typical context of appearance:**
C1403 usually appears after electrical or mechanical mishaps, such as during a system self-test, after a repair, or when experiencing **traction or ABS warning lights**. It may also be coupled with other related codes, indicating a broader electrical fault within the ABS module or wiring harness.

Most likely causes of trouble code C1403

This fault is often linked to electrical or component failures within the ABS system. Here’s a ranked list of probable causes:

1. **Damaged or worn wiring harness** — The most common cause, especially if the wiring has been subject to corrosion, abrasion, or forceful contact.
2. **Shorted traction control valve** — The valve itself might have developed an internal short due to age or manufacturing defect.
3. **Faulty ABS control module** — An internal fault in the control unit could trigger false detection of circuit shorts.
4. **Corrosion or dirt within the connector terminal** — Water ingress or debris can cause poor electrical contact, leading to shorts.
5. **Previous electrical repairs or modifications** — Incorrect wiring or improper installation can introduce shorts.
6. **Battery or charging system issues** — Excessive voltage fluctuations can damage sensitive ABS circuitry, causing shorts.

Addressing the most probable causes first helps streamline diagnosis and repair.

How to diagnose trouble code C1403

Diagnosing C1403 requires a systematic approach to identify whether the fault lies in wiring, the valve, or the control unit.

**Basic diagnostic steps include:**
1. Visual inspection: Check wiring harnesses, connectors, and insulation around the RF wheel and ABS module for damage, corrosion, or loose connections.
2. Scan live data: Use an OBD-II scanner to monitor ABS system readings and electrical signals of the RF circuit while gently actuating the traction control system.
3. Continuity testing: With a multimeter, verify the wiring circuit for shorts, open circuits, or abnormal resistances, especially between the circuit and battery or ground.
4. Inspect the traction control valve: Remove and examine the valve for signs of damage or internal shorting if accessible.
5. Check fuse and relay states: Confirm the integrity of related fuses and relays; a faulty relay can sometimes cause electrical shorts.

**Note:** If no external wiring faults are visible, the next step involves testing the internal components and further diagnostics with manufacturer-specific tools or procedures.

Frequent mistakes with trouble code C1403

Diagnosing and repairing C1403 requires careful attention to detail. Common mistakes include:

  • Jumping directly to replacing the ABS module without verifying wiring integrity first.
  • Ignoring visual clues like damaged wiring or connectors that could pinpoint the fault.
  • Replacing parts blindly without conducting proper continuity or resistance tests.
  • Overlooking the possibility of voltage irregularities caused by the battery or alternator condition.
  • Failing to clear DTCs after repair, leading to misinterpretation of system status.
  • Not performing a full system reset or calibration after repairs, which can cause the code to return.

**Best practice:** Follow a methodical approach, verify every step with diagnostic tools, and adhere to manufacturer specifications to prevent recurrence.
